Most of my adults tend to hang around one another. They burrow into the same holes and hide under the same logs. There's always groups of them together in my pen, and its not lack of space either as there is plenty of room for them to avoid one another.

My babies don't fight at all unless they're trying to pull food out each other's mouth. They're some what crowded, since I have 25 of them in a 30 gallon tank right now. There's still alot of room for them thoough.
